On August 27, 2025, in alignment with China’s fast-emerging low-altitude economy, the Jiangsu UAV Application Skills Competition Final was held at Jiangsu Jiaotong College. Jointly organized by the Jiangsu Federation of Trade Unions and the Jiangsu Provincial Comprehensive Transportation Society, the event was designed to follow the rising low-altitude economy, highlight the active role of application skills competition in building the industrial application system, and support the sector’s sustainable development.
The competition was co-hosted by the Low-Altitude Economy Industry Research Institute of the Jiangsu Provincial Comprehensive Transportation Society, JSTI Group, and Jiangsu Aviation Enterprises Group Inc., among others. Attendees included senior provincial leaders such as Wei Guoqiang (Vice Chairman of the Standing Committee of the Jiangsu Provincial People's Congress and Chairman of the Jiangsu Federation of Trade Unions), Shi Heping (Former Vice Governor of Jiangsu Provincial People's Government and President of the Jiangsu Provincial Comprehensive Transportation Society), Wu Yonghong (Secretary of the Party Committee and Director-General of the Jiangsu Provincial Department of Transportation) and Yin Min (Member of the Standing Committee of the Zhenjiang Municipal Party Committee and Director of the Publicity Department of the CPC Zhenjiang Municipal Committee). More than 160 attendees, including representatives from the organizing and executive committees as well as competitors and team leaders, joined the opening ceremony.
As a co-construction partner of the Low-Altitude Economy Industry Research Institute and a recognized innovator in the low-altitude sector, Duolun Technology was invited to participate in the event. At its dedicated exhibition booth, the company showcased two of its cutting-edge solutions for smart airports and low-altitude security: the Unmanned Airport Perimeter Intelligent Defense System and the Low-Altitude Bird Detection and Prevention System, which drew significant interest from government leaders, industry experts, and competition attendees.
Built on intelligent sensing, AI-powered image analysis, and automated control technologies, Duolun Technology’s Unmanned Airport Perimeter Intelligent Defense System enables three-dimensional defense, real-time monitoring, and intelligent alerts across airport perimeters and airspace up to 300 meters. Integrated with unmanned patrol and response vehicles, the system strengthens decision support, early-warning coordination, and emergency response capabilities. It enhances the automation and autonomy of airport security operations, significantly boosting response efficiency while reducing labor costs.
Another innovative product - the Low-Altitude Bird Detection and Prevention System-focuses on bird-strike prevention. Using a combination of high-precision radar, optical, and thermal imaging technologies, the system delivers highly accurate identification, all-weather monitoring, and flight-path prediction of bird activities. It can provide real-time alerts for airports, wind farms, and other facilities, and can be linked with integrated bird-dispersal devices to actively deter birds, effectively mitigating bird strike risks and safeguarding low-altitude operations.
